Non-Degree Students

Thank you for your interest in Sophia University! Non-degree students are those who enroll in either the Faculty of Liberal Arts (FLA) or Center for Language Education and Research (CLER) to take undergraduate courses and obtain credits but do not intend to receive an academic degree. This status is applicable only to international students who will enroll as full-time students.

※For Non-Degree programs information in Japanese, please refer to our Japanese website.

▼If you have a Japanese passport or a valid status of residence in Japan, also see below.

Non-Matriculated Students (Kamokuto Rishusei)

上智大学 Sophia University Sophia U